You need to make notes about any lost income. This means any lost wages due to being absent from work due to your injuries. Additionally, you can include any money lost because you couldn't attend your college classes.
Check the American Bar Association. You will likely need a good attorney when it comes time to file your case. The American Bar Association (ABA) is a great starting place. While they don't offer reviews or ratings, you can find out if a potential lawyer is in good standing or if he or she has had any disciplinary action taken.
If you are in pain after an accident, be very vocal about it and never try to hold the feelings in. This is not a good idea because it will give the other party leverage during a lawsuit. They will argue that you never said that you were injured at the time of the accident.

Do not stretch the truth in order to get a bigger settlement in a lawsuit. Many people who are really injured do this, and it results in them having their entire case thrown out. The best thing to do is to be honest and hope for the best with your case.
A very common type of personal injury lawsuit can be brought against a property owner when a customer slips or falls on their property. If you fall and get hurt because of unsafe conditions, the property owner can be held liable for your medical costs. Make sure you make a detailed record of the situation.
You may not need to talk to a lawyer immediately if it's just a bit of pain following an accident. Sometimes it just goes away. If the issue lingers, though, you should think about contacting an attorney.
Prepare all the paperwork related to your personal injury and medical treatment before meeting with your lawyer for the first time. This may include a letter from your insurance company or a bill for medical services. These documents can assist your lawyer, so he can determine whether he can take you on.
If you are a communicator, a person who likes to be in touch whenever you have a question or information to share, choose a small law firm for your personal injury case. These firms are easier to get in touch with as their work loads tend to be smaller, ensuring you get the attention you require.

Tell every doctor that you see that you are going to court for a personal injury claim. This will let the doctor know that you will be expecting him to document your injuries, treatments and progress, or lack there of, for use in court. If you fail to do this, you may not win your case.

A contingency contract means that the lawyer doesn't get paid unless he wins your case. Most contingency contracts state that the attorney will receive a portion of your settlement if the case is won. To protect yourself, thoroughly read the contingency contract and agree on the percentage the lawyer is entitled to if he wins your case.
If you are seeking a personal injury attorney, consult with an attorney that you already know and trust. If you have someone who has represented you in a real estate transaction or drawn up a will for you, that is a good starting place. While this person might not take personal injury cases, he might be able to refer you to a trusted colleague who does.
Make sure that a limited tort does not apply to your personal injury claim. Sometimes people are limited but it can be nullified if the at fault party has previous convictions for DUI. You do not want to have your settlement limited. Check and make sure that a limited tort does not apply.
Your personal injuries will result in your loss of wages. Provide accurate information of your salary, and how much time you had from work due to your injuries. In addition to recovering cost of your medical treatment, your attorney will try to recover your salary and an award for pain and suffering that you had to endure.
If you suffer an injury, make sure to retain all paperwork and financial receipts pertaining to it. They prove what you've had to spend after your injury. You might not be reimbursed in court if you don't have these receipts.
If you have never dealt with a case like this before, don't try to settle it by yourself. While you may think a lawyer is expensive, the cost of getting nothing in your settlement thanks to dirty pool in contracts signed will be even higher! Hire a lawyer and do it right.
Photographs often play a huge role in your case, especially in a motor vehicle accident. Take a photo of the other driver's license, insurance and registration. Take photos of the damage and any injuries you may have. Also, take a photo of the other driver in case they try to claim fake injuries later.
